I am suppose to jump a and b then take off connetor. How am i suppose to jump a and b while it is still connected. Also am i supposed to adjust the IAC in drive and/or at a certain temp?
The simplest way to do it is with a scantool. Get the IAC readings and adjust the Throttle Blades till you get a count between 20 - 30.
Your method requires that you short out the A & B terminals of the ALDL and turn the car to run, wait 30 seconds, remove the wires of the IAC at the plug and turn the car off. Remove the short and start the car. Set the base idle to around 450 and then shut it off. Reconnect the IAC and start it up. Set TPS to whatever the specs are.
